
Dual operational amplifier featuring 1MHz bandwidth and 120dB voltage gain. CMOS technology supports rail-to-rail input and output, with a maximum dual supply voltage of 6V and a maximum single supply voltage of 12V. This surface mount device offers 750µV input offset voltage and 10pA input bias current, operating across a temperature range of -40°C to 85°C. Packaged in 8-VSSOP on tape and reel, it provides 0.6V/µs slew rate and 10mA output current per channel.
